Description:
The Gibson J-45 Standard is a Dreadnought-style guitar and is part of Gibson's Round Shoulder series. In production since the 1940s, the J-45 remains one of the best-selling guitars in the Gibson Acoustic catalog, also suitable for studio recording use.
It features a scalloped bracing, a four-layer binding on the top, mother-of-pearl inlays, and vintage nickel-plated tuning machines. The top is made of solid Sitka spruce, while the back and sides are constructed from solid Honduran mahogany, and the bridge and fingerboard are made of rosewood.
The new version is characterized by improved electronics, the L.R. Baggs Element VTC, enhanced playability due to a neck designed for a more comfortable grip, frets processed with PLEK technology, and a new finish that is even more beautiful and glossy.
In particular, this Exclusive version features a stunning Honey Burst coloration.
